All rights reserved. + * + * Licensed under GPLv2 or later, see file LICENSE in this tarball for details. + * + * Original copyright notice is retained at the end of this file. + */ + +/* BB_AUDIT SUSv3 compliant -- unless configured as fancy echo. */ +/* http://www.opengroup.org/onlinepubs/007904975/utilities/echo.html */ + +/* Mar 16, 2003 Manuel Novoa III (mjn3@codepoet.org) + * + * Because of behavioral differences, implemented configurable SUSv3 + * or 'fancy' gnu-ish behaviors. Also, reduced size and fixed bugs. + * 1) In handling '\c' escape, the previous version only suppressed the + * trailing newline. SUSv3 specifies _no_ output after '\c'. + * 2) SUSv3 specifies that octal escapes are of the form \0{#{#{#}}}. + * The previous version did not allow 4-digit octals. + */ + +#include +#include +#include + +#define WANT_HEX_ESCAPES 1 + +/* Usual "this only works for ascii compatible encodings" disclaimer. */ +#undef _tolower +#define _tolower(X) ((X)|((char) 0x20)) + +static char bb_process_escape_sequence(const char **ptr) +{ + static const char charmap[] = { + 'a', 'b', 'f', 'n', 'r', 't', 'v', '\\', 0, + '\a', '\b', '\f', '\n', '\r', '\t', '\v', '\\', '\\' }; + + const char *p; + const char *q; + unsigned int num_digits; + unsigned int r; + unsigned int n; + unsigned int d; + unsigned int base; + + num_digits = n = 0; + base = 8; + q = *ptr; + +#ifdef WANT_HEX_ESCAPES + if (*q == 'x') { + ++q; + base = 16; + ++num_digits; + } +#endif + + do { + d = (unsigned char)(*q) - '0'; +#ifdef WANT_HEX_ESCAPES + if (d >= 10) { + d = (unsigned char)(_tolower(*q)) - 'a' + 10; + } +#endif + + if (d >= base) { +#ifdef WANT_HEX_ESCAPES + if ((base == 16) && (!--num_digits)) { +/* return '\\'; */ + --q; + } +#endif + break; + } + + r = n * base + d; + if (r > UCHAR_MAX) { + break; + } + + n = r; + ++q; + } while (++num_digits < 3); + + if (num_digits == 0) { /* mnemonic escape sequence? */ + p = charmap; + do { + if (*p == *q) { + q++; + break; + } + } while (*++p); + n = *(p + (sizeof(charmap)/2)); + } + + *ptr = q; + + return (char) n; +} + + +int main(int argc, char **argv) +{ + const char *arg; + const char *p; + char nflag = 1; + char eflag = 0; + + /* We must check that stdout is not closed. */ + if (dup2(1, 1) != 1) + return -1; + + while (1) { + arg = *++argv; + if (!arg) + goto newline_ret; + if (*arg != '-') + break; + + /* If it appears that we are handling options, then make sure + * that all of the options specified are actually valid. + * Otherwise, the string should just be echoed. + */ + p = arg + 1; + if (!*p) /* A single '-', so echo it. */ + goto just_echo; + + do { + if (!strrchr("neE", *p)) + goto just_echo; + } while (*++p); + + /* All of the options in this arg are valid, so handle them. */ + p = arg + 1; + do { + if (*p == 'n') + nflag = 0; + if (*p == 'e') + eflag = '\\'; + } while (*++p); + } + just_echo: + while (1) { + /* arg is already == *argv and isn't NULL */ + int c; + + if (!eflag) { + /* optimization for very common case */ + fputs(arg, stdout); + } else while ((c = *arg++)) { + if (c == eflag) { /* Check for escape seq. */ + if (*arg == 'c') { + /* '\c' means cancel newline and + * ignore all subsequent chars. */ + goto ret; + } + { + /* Since SUSv3 mandates a first digit of 0, 4-digit octals + * of the form \0### are accepted. */ + if (*arg == '0') { + /* NB: don't turn "...\0" into "...\" */ + if (arg[1] && ((unsigned char)(arg[1]) - '0') < 8) { + arg++; + } + } + /* bb_process_escape_sequence handles NUL correctly + * ("...\" case. */ + c = bb_process_escape_sequence(&arg); + } + } + putchar(c); + } + + arg = *++argv; + if (!arg) + break; + putchar(' '); + } + + newline_ret: + if (nflag) { + putchar('\n'); + } + ret: + return fflush(stdout); +} + +/*- + * Copyright (c) 1991, 1993 + * The Regents of the University of California.
